Ideal Water-proof Attributes for Nomadic Real Estate



Surviving wheels, on water, or off the grid suggests surrendering a great deal of the comforts of a taken care of address. One thing you can't afford to quit, however, is remaining completely dry. Whether you're parked in a van, put into a yurt, or drifting on a houseboat, water finds every seam, gap, and weak point ultimately. Building or retrofitting a nomadic home with the ideal waterproofing functions isn't almost convenience-- it shields your financial investment, your health, and your ability to keep moving whenever you select.

Why Waterproofing Matters Much More for Mobile Homes



Conventional homes sit still. Nomadic structures do not. They bend on rough roadways, shift with temperature level swings, and obtain struck by rainfall and wind from every angle relying on where they're parked. That constant movement stresses seals and joints in methods a stationary building never ever experiences. A leak that would be a small nuisance in a house can quickly come to be mold, rot, or electrical damages in a little home on wheels, where every little thing is packed close together and dampness has nowhere to leave.

The Hidden Expense of Tiny Leakages



A pinhole leak in a roof covering seam could go unnoticed for months, especially if it's above a closet or behind insulation. By the time you smell it, the damage is usually structural. For nomadic occupants, this matters much more due to the fact that repair work when traveling are harder to set up, and resale worth depends heavily on a dry, mold-free inside.

Roof Solutions Constructed for Movement



The roofing system takes one of the most misuse, so it is worthy of one of the most focus. Rubber membrane roof, such as EPDM, is prominent in van and motor home conversions because it stretches a little with the structure instead of breaking. Steel roof coverings with standing seams are one more solid alternative, especially for tiny homes on trailers, because the elevated joints shed water without depending on caulk alone.

Sealers That Actually Flex



Inflexible caulks fracture under vibration. Search for polyurethane or butyl-based sealants made for aquatic or RV use-- they remain adaptable through temperature modifications and consistent activity, which matters far more on a moving structure than on a home structure.

Skylight and Vent Covers



Every opening cut into a roof covering is a potential leak point. Increased, gasketed covers over skylights and roofing system vents let you maintain home windows split for air movement also in light rainfall, without water merging and seeping through the frame.

Walls, Windows, and Doors That Keep Water Out



Water rarely goes into with open air; it goes into with voids at joints and openings. Nomadic homes gain from double or triple-sealed door frames, where a second gasket catches anything that gets past the primary seal. Awning-style windows, which open external and descending, lost rainfall normally, unlike gliding windows that can catch water in their tracks.

Drip Edges and Overhangs



Small overhangs above doors and windows redirect water away from seals before it even reaches them. On a compact structure, even a few inches of overhang can significantly cut how much water pressure develops against a seam during heavy rain.

Floor Covering and Structure Defense



Water that enters from below is equally as harmful as water from above, particularly for homes that ford pools, rest on wet ground, or float. Marine-grade plywood treated with water-proof sealer withstands swelling much much better than basic lumber. For frameworks on trailers, undercoating the framework with a rubberized spray shields against splash-up from roadways and creek crossings.

Vapor Barriers Under Insulation



Dampness doesn't just come from outside. Condensation forming inside wall surfaces from day-to-day living-- food preparation, showering, breathing-- can soak insulation from within. A correctly installed vapor obstacle between the wall and insulation keeps that inner wetness from becoming a surprise trouble.

Air flow as a Waterproofing Approach



It appears counterintuitive, but air movement is among one of the most reliable waterproofing tools readily available. Caught moisture condenses on cool surface areas and gradually fills materials from the inside. Roof air vent followers, cross-breeze home windows, and evaporating vents all function to maintain indoor air completely dry sufficient that any kind of percentage of wetness that does get in can evaporate prior to it causes damage.

Upkeep Practices That Extend Waterproofing



Even the very best products stop working without maintenance. Nomadic residents need to examine roofing system joints and window seals every few months, given that the vibration of travel loosens up fasteners and stretches sealant faster than in stationary homes. Reapplying joint tape or sealer annually is a little job that avoids pricey repair work later.

Seasonal Checks Before Long Trips



Before any type of extended trip, a fast walk-around checking rain gutters, vents, and door seals can capture tiny problems prior to they come to be trip-ending issues.

Final Thoughts



Waterproofing a nomadic home is less about one excellent item and more about layering several reliable systems-- adaptable seals, clever roofing system design, proper air flow, and constant upkeep. Obtain those layers right, and your home stays completely dry regardless of where the road, route, or tide takes you following.
